How the LivCam Token System Feeds Model Earnings
Viewer spending on LivCam flows entirely through tokens. When a user purchases tokens with a credit or debit card, those tokens are used to tip performers, access private shows, spy on ongoing sessions, or activate cam-to-cam features. Every token transaction on the viewer's side represents potential income for the model receiving it.

This structure is standard across the live cam vertical. Platforms separate the viewer-facing payment system from the model-facing payout system, giving the platform control over exchange rates and processing schedules. According to industry analysis of comparable platforms, token-to-cash conversion rates typically range from 2 to 6 pence per token depending on the platform's margin and the performer's tier.
For UK performers specifically, the currency conversion layer adds a consideration. LivCam is operated by a Cyprus-based company, so earnings may be processed in a base currency before being converted to GBP. Performers should review the platform's terms carefully to understand whether exchange fees apply at the point of withdrawal.
Verification Requirements Before Any Payout
No model on LivCam receives a payout without first completing identity verification. The process requires a government-issued photo ID alongside a selfie holding that document. This two-step check aligns with standard Know Your Customer practice and satisfies age-verification obligations that apply across the adult content sector in the UK.

The UK's Online Safety Act, which received Royal Assent in October 2023, places stricter age-verification duties on platforms distributing adult content to British users. For models, this regulatory environment means verification is not merely a platform formality. It is a compliance checkpoint that protects both the performer and the platform from legal exposure. Completing the LivCam verification process promptly is therefore a practical prerequisite for unlocking earnings.
Performers who delay verification may find their earnings held until the check is complete. There is no evidence in the available data that LivCam releases funds before identity documents have been reviewed and approved.

Withdrawal Process and Known Constraints
The platform's documentation confirms that tokens held in inactive accounts may be forfeited over time. This is a meaningful constraint for performers who broadcast irregularly. Maintaining account activity is therefore not only a revenue strategy but also a safeguard against losing accrued earnings.
Refund policy on the viewer side is also relevant context. Tips and spying charges are explicitly non-refundable. Only technical malfunctions or provably unsatisfactory private shows may qualify for a refund on the viewer's end. For models, this means income from tips and spy sessions carries a lower reversal risk than income from private shows, which carry a slim but non-zero chargeback exposure.
UK performers should also be aware of standard self-employment tax obligations. Earnings from live cam work are taxable income under HMRC rules. Performers operating as sole traders must declare token-converted income in their self-assessment returns. HMRC's guidance on platform-based income has been updated as part of broader digital economy reporting requirements that took effect from the 2024 to 2025 tax year.
